Solution Overview

Problem

Existing foldable electronic devices with fixed free stop function angles pose difficulties in unfolding or folding with one hand, as the fixed angle range restricts user convenience.

Innovation Solution

A hinge module with a flexible section that allows the free stop function to be implemented at varying angles, enabling the foldable electronic device to adapt to different user scenarios, such as one-handed operation.

Solution Approach 1:

The system dynamically switches between different angle ranges for the flex section based on the detected operation mode. During folding/unfolding operations, a smaller angle range is used to reduce resistance. During usage modes (viewing, photographing, editing), a larger angle range is activated to provide stable stopping positions. This temporal separation of functions allows the system to optimize for one-handed operation without permanently restricting free stop functionality.

Solution Approach 2:

The hinge module periodically transitions between different operational states with different angle ranges. The control module detects the current state (folding, unfolding, or usage) and adjusts the flex section angle range accordingly. This periodic switching between configurations allows the system to provide appropriate mechanical characteristics for each phase of operation, resolving the contradiction between ease of operation and adaptability.

An embodiment of the present disclosure may provide an electronic device including a hinge module. The electronic device may include a hinge module including: a rotating member connected to a housing; a first arm member including one end which includes a first cam structure and the other end which includes a first protrusion formed therefrom; a second arm member including one end which includes a second cam structure and the other end which includes a second protrusion formed therefrom; and a guide member connected to the rotating member and including a first surface having a first rail in which the first protrusion of the first arm member is accommodated, and a second surface including a second rail in which the second protrusion of the second arm member is accommodated.
